What Is the Cost of Living Near Billings?

Understanding the cost of living near Billings is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Big Dipper Ceramics.
Billings' Cost of Living Index is approximately 94.9 (5.1% less expensive than US average; 5.8% less than MT average). Largest MT city, affordable housing for MT. MET Transit. When planning your budget based on a salary from Big Dipper Ceramics, consider these typical monthly expenses:

FAQ 5: Why might an individual's actual salary at Big Dipper Ceramics differ from the ranges shown here?
An individual's actual salary at Big Dipper Ceramics can differ from our estimated ranges due to various factors. These include their specific years of experience in the role, unique skills or certifications, educational background, performance record, the specific team or department they join, negotiation outcomes, and even the precise timing of when they were hired relative to market fluctuations. Our ranges represent typical compensation.
